Get a quoteWebThe wheel loader is modeled as a mechanical manipulator with four degrees of freedom (DOFs), which comprises a seven-bar linkage using the symbolic notation of Denavit and Hartenberg. Homogeneous transformation matrices are used to capture the spatial configuration between adjacent links.

Get a quoteWebThis training simulator was developed by ForgeFX for Komatsu's front-end wheel loader, the LeTourneau 2350. Connected to a pair of original equipment manufacturer (OEM) controllers, the simulated front-end loader operates and moves in a virtual world in the same way as the real-world front-end loader.
